Plastic up-cycling pioneers in COP 27

If you’ve heard of COP 27 you most likely know the green zone area. Inside this area, Up-fuse shared a booth with our collaborators the Egyptian Clothing Bank where we showcased our products that are made from up-cycling plastic bags. We were also the producers of the official giveaway that was distributed among all cop27 participants. We specialize in up-cycling waste and plastic, hence we were able to produce 40 thousand tote bags using 300 thousand up-cycled plastic bags. 100 women in Mansheyet Nasser were hired to complete this mission.
